A Day in the Life Podcast

I created this podcast at the height of the pandemic with the intention to share stories of everyday people. In a time of isolation and division, it’s important to remember that we have more in common than we have differences.

A Day in the Life was born out of my interest in reconnecting with friends and acquaintances to learn more about what they actually do for work and in their day-to-day lives. Right now, I am not doing any new episodes, but please do feel free to explore past episodes.
